Cleland to Middlesbrough by train

A train trip from Cleland to Middlesbrough takes about 5hrs 7 mins on average, covering roughly 135 miles (217 kilometres). With around 18 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£16.70,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Cleland to Middlesbrough start from as little as £16.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Cleland to Middlesbrough start from £57.20 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Cleland to Middlesbrough are available for £75.80 one way

Facilities at Cleland Station

Cleland station offers a basic yet functional environment for travelers on the move. Notably, the station does not have a ticket office or ticket machines, encouraging passengers to plan ahead and purchase tickets online. It's practical to note that there are no ref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s, so grabbing a bite or some cash before you arrive might be wise.

Despite its simplicity, the station ensures comfort through a seating area and step-free access across the premises. Travelers with smartcards can use the installed validators, and those needing assistance may find help points and departure screens for guidance. Cleland is also equipped with security measures such as CCTV, ensuring passengers can travel with peace of mind.

Transportation Links and Accessibility

The station's location is convenient for those who prefer traveling by public transportation beyond just trains. Rail replacement buses, when required, conveniently pick up and drop off on Bellside Road. For more flexible travel options, consider reaching out to local taxis via traintaxi.co.uk. Bus services can be explored further through Traveline Scotland or by calling their operational line.

Facilities and Amenities

Middlesbrough Station ensures a smooth travel experience with a variety of amenities designed to cater to all travelers. The ticket office is open from 5:30 to 19: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, with slightly shorter hours on Sundays, ensuring ample opportunity for ticket collection and inquiries. Alternatively, ticket machines are readily accessible at the station, with options to collect tickets purchased online. Middlesbrough Station is also equipped with an induction loop for those with hearing impairments, and there's step-free access throughout the station, making it accessible for wheelchair users.

For those looking to grab a quick bite or coffee before continuing their journey, refreshment facilities are available on the station concourse. There are also heated waiting rooms on both platforms, ensuring comfort in colder months. While there is no luggage storage, the station is surveilled by CCTV for added security.

Onward Travel Options

Accessibility for onward travel is a key feature of Middlesbrough Station. The nearest taxi rank is conveniently located at the Bridge Street entrance, while local bus services operate nearby to take you further into Middlesbrough or surrounding areas. For those needing rail replacement services, pick-up and drop-off are located in the layby on Bridge Street at the rear of the station.
